Grant of Disability Pension


Ministry of Defence
Grant of Disability Pension
31 DEC 2018
As per Ministry of Defence order dated 31.01.2001, Armed Forces Personnel who retire voluntarily / or seek discharge on request are not eligible for any award on account of disability. Provided that Armed Forces Personnel who are due for retirement / discharge on completion of tenure, or on completion of service limits, or on completion of the terms of engagement or on attaining the prescribed age of retirement, and who seeks pre-mature retirement / discharge on request for the purpose of getting higher commutation value of pension will remain eligible for disability element.
Further, Armed Forces personnel who are retained in service despite disability, which is accepted as attributable to or aggravated by Military Service and have forgone lump sum compensation in lieu of that disability, may be given disability element / war injury element at the time of their retirement / discharge whether voluntary or otherwise in addition to Retiring / Service Pension or Retiring / Service Gratuity. These provisions are effective from 1.1.2006

This information was given by Raksha Rajya Mantri Dr. Subhash Bhamre in a written reply to Shri Sanjay Seth in Rajya Sabha today.
